#Global Unicorn Index 2023: Non-Listed Companies With a Value of Over $1 Billion

According to reports, Hurun Research Institute released the Global Unicorn Index 2023 in Guangzhou today, listing non listed companies with a value of over $1 billion that were established globally after 2000. The deadline for the valuation calculation of this ranking is December 31, 2022. There are currently 1361 unicorn companies worldwide, distributed in 48 countries and 271 cities. The total value of global unicorn enterprises is 4.3 trillion US dollars (approximately 30 trillion RMB), an increase of 17% compared to a year ago and more than twice that before the epidemic. From the perspective of the number of unicorns, the fintech industry has grown the fastest, with an increase of 32 compared to a year ago. Fintech has 171 unicorns, making it the industry with the highest number of unicorn enterprises globally, followed by software services (136), e-commerce (120), and artificial intelligence (105). The United States leads with 666 unicorn companies, China ranks second with 316, India remains third, and the UK ranks fourth.

A total of 53 unicorn enterprises in the blockchain industry have been shortlisted in Hurun’s 2023 Global Unicorn List
